Alienware Command Center Custom Lighting Settings Do Not Work in a Video Game on an Alienware Area-51 AAT2250 or Alienware Aurora ACT1250
Summary: Learn what to do if Alienware Command Center ecosystem lighting presets do not load for a game on an Alienware Area-51 AAT2250 or Alienware Aurora ACT1250.

Symptoms
An Alienware Area-51 AAT2250 or Alienware Aurora ACT1250 may use default lighting settings instead of customized lighting settings in Alienware Command Center (AWCC).
Affected Platforms:
- Alienware Area-51 AAT2250
- Alienware Aurora ACT1250
Affected Software:
- Alienware Command Center
Customized lighting settings are configured in Alienware Command Center.
- Go to Alienware Command Center and then click Home.
- Select the game that you want to set custom lighting settings for and then click CUSTOMIZE.
- Under ECOSYSTEM LIGHTING PRESETS, add lighting presets for the game.
The lighting reverts to the default setting if the Lighting Preset Switch is set to SYSTEM.
- Go to Alienware Command Center.
- Go to SETTINGS, then select GLOBAL PRESET.
- Set the Lighting Preset Switch to SYSTEM.
Cause
An Alienware Command Center issue causes this behavior.
Resolution
Long-term Resolution
The engineering department is working on a fix to be released in Alienware Command Center version 6.9 and later. The updated version is posted to the computer's support page once it is made available. Alienware Command Center version 6.9 is expected to be released in August 2025.
Workaround
Switch to the PER GAME setting for game and app lighting.
- Go to Alienware Command Center.
- Go to SETTINGS, then select GLOBAL PRESET.
- Set the Lighting Preset Switch to PER GAME.
